// Multipart parts are staged and become visible only after CompleteMultipartUpload,
// which uses the normal publication-fenced authorization path.
async fn authorize_staged_multipart_part<T>(req: &mut S3Request<T>) -> S3Result<()> {
req.extensions.insert(StagedMultipartPartAuthorization);
let result = authorize_request(req, Action::S3Action(S3Action::PutObjectAction)).await;
req.extensions.remove::<StagedMultipartPartAuthorization>();
result
}
